About First Philippine Industrial Park
First Philippine Industrial Park, Inc. (FPIP) is the owner, developer, and manager of the leading industrial property in the Philippines. Established in 1997, FPIP is a 457-hectare property strategically located in the CALABARZON (Cavite-Laguna-Batangas-Rizal-Quezon) industrial region south of Manila. FPIP was established as a response to the call of the Philippine government to help in the task of nation-building through the development and management of world-class facilities designed to host global companies.
FPIP is a joint venture between one of the Philippines' largest conglomerates, First Philippine Holdings Corporation (FPH) and Sumitomo Corporation of Japan.
FPH is a major publicly listed company with core businesses in power and energy and strategic initiatives in media, semiconductors, solar energy, telecommunications, property, infrastructure, and manufacturing.
Sumitomo Corporation is a global leader in the trade and distribution of steel, chemicals, mining, construction, and financial and logistics services. Sumitomo's team of more than 6,3299 employees in almost 66 countries can handle all aspects of virtually any project, including planning, sourcing financing, logistics, insurance, and marketing anywhere in the world. The Company now calls itself an Integrated Business Enterprise, a term more adequately capturing its diverse scope and status. The Company has experience in industrial park management, development, and marketing in 12 locations across Asia.
FPH and Sumitomo Corporation combine competencies, experiences, and culture. They define a corporate synergy that ensures the realization of a truly world-class First Philippine Industrial Park.
FPIP is an Integrated Management System (IMS) certified company that adheres to international quality, environment, and health and safety standards. It is certified by Certification International (CI) and continually adheres to the highest quality standards of customer service.
